Beaujolais
variable noun: Beaujolais is a type of red wine that comes from the region of eastern France called Beaujolais.

Beaujolais in American English
light, fruity red wine from the Beaujolais district in southern Burgundy
noun: a dry, fruity red Burgundy wine that does not age and usually must be drunk within a few months after it is made

beaujolais in British English
noun: a popular fresh-tasting red or white wine from southern Burgundy in France
